Overdoses from prescription opioid drugs now kill nearly seventeen thousand americans every year. Thats one overdose death every thirty minutes. The overdose rate which might have been 1 or 2 a month in our Emergency Department is now more like 3 or 4 or 5 if not more than that, in a 24hour period. Thats a massive increase. Massive. Over the past 10 years, weve had more than 125,000 americans lose their lives to painkiller Overdose Deaths. The food and Drug Administration recently approved a powerful new opioid painkiller called zohydro over the objections of its own medical advisors and dozens of lawmakers. I thought we had learned our lesson with oxycontin. How can you say with any degree of confidence that zohydro wont be abused . Youre going to have people die. This week fault lines looks at the battle over the most popular drugs in america opioid painkillers. There is big controversy tonight involving a new narcotic painkiller.
